New MG ZS SUV partially revealed ahead of August 26 debut

MG Motor is set to unveil the all-new ZS SUV, marking a significant update for the popular model. With a redesigned exterior, new powertrain options, and advanced features, the 2024 ZS aims to strengthen its position in the competitive compact SUV segment.

A Bold New Look

The upcoming ZS boasts a refreshed exterior design, featuring a wider and more prominent grille, along with sleek, wraparound headlights. The overall silhouette remains similar, but the finer details have been updated to give the SUV a more modern and sophisticated appearance.

Hybrid Powertrain

One of the highlights of the new ZS is the introduction of a petrol-hybrid powertrain option. This move aligns with the global trend towards electrification and demonstrates MG’s commitment to sustainable mobility. The specific details of the hybrid system, including battery capacity and power output, are yet to be revealed.

Potential Powertrain Options

While the hybrid powertrain is confirmed, it is likely that MG will also offer traditional petrol engine options for the ZS. A turbocharged petrol engine could be a strong possibility, considering the growing preference for performance-oriented SUVs in the Indian market.

Launch Timeline and India Plans

The new MG ZS will make its global debut in Australia before being introduced in other markets, including India. The launch timeline for the Indian market is expected to be sometime next year. MG Motor India is also gearing up for the launch of the Windsor EV and the facelift of the Gloster SUV in the coming months.
